Founded in 2007 by Mario Paoluzi in collaboration with Etna expert Salvo Foti, I Custodi delle Vigne dell’Etna acts as the "guardians" of the volcano’s ancient viticultural heritage. The winery prioritizes organic and biodynamic farming, utilizing traditional manual labor and the help of a mule named Ciccio to maintain century-old, bush-trained albarello vines. Working within the historic I Vigneri guild, they restore dry-stone lava terraces to preserve the unique volcanic landscape while producing wines that emphasize elegance, minerality, and long aging. Their flagship bottlings, like the Aetneus, are crafted from high-altitude vineyards on Etna's north slope to showcase the "raw emotion" and complexity of the mountain’s terroir.

Winemaking
Fermented in stainless steel tanks, aged for 18 to 24 months in used 500-liter French oak tonneaux followed by an additional 12 to 18 months aging in bottle before release.
